Jungle Camp: Suddenly, Gil Ofarim is talking about his trial after all
Gil Ofarim, previously silent on his defamation trial, has begun to discuss it during his participation in the reality show 'Jungle Camp.'
Gil Ofarim has been grappling with the repercussions of his 2023 defamation trial, which has impacted his public image significantly. While participating in the RTL reality show 'Jungle Camp,' he had previously chosen to remain silent on the matter. However, recent interactions on the show have led him to whisper details about his experiences and the complexities surrounding the trial to a fellow contestant, exposing layers of confusion and miscommunication.
